| Subject | [PATCH net-next 4/9] net: dsa: mv88e6xxx: allocate the number of ports |
| Message-ID | <tqsxQ-3KK-17@gated-at.bofh.it> |
The current code allocates DSA_MAX_PORTS ports for a Marvell dsa_switch structure. Provide the exact number of ports so the corresponding ds->num_ports is accurate. Signed-off-by: Vivien Didelot <vivien.didelot@savoirfairelinux.com> --- drivers/net/dsa/mv88e6xxx/chip.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/drivers/net/dsa/mv88e6xxx/chip.c b/drivers/net/dsa/mv88e6xxx/chip.c index 955c7e672423..b114bf8e6a11 100644 --- a/drivers/net/dsa/mv88e6xxx/chip.c +++ b/drivers/net/dsa/mv88e6xxx/chip.c @@ -4286,7 +4286,7 @@ static int mv88e6xxx_register_switch(struct mv88e6xxx_chip *chip) struct device *dev = chip->dev; struct dsa_switch *ds; - ds = dsa_switch_alloc(dev, DSA_MAX_PORTS); + ds = dsa_switch_alloc(dev, mv88e6xxx_num_ports(chip)); if (!ds) return -ENOMEM; -- 2.12.1

> Is net/dsa/dsa.c: dsa_switch_setup() still used? If it is, won't that
> invalidate your assumption about ds->num_ports.
I think dsa_switch_setup is part of the legacy code and is likely to be
removed soon.
But this is not an issue per-se. What happens if the switch is allocated
with DSA_MAX_PORTS ports instead of the correct number, is that the PVT
will be programmed to allow the non-existent port IDs to egress frames
on the CPU port and DSA links only.
